电信设备-基于源码修改的信息隐藏方法.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在电信设备领域,信息隐藏是一种重要的技术,它主要用于保护数据安全、实现版权保护以及进行秘密通信。本资料“电信设备-基于源码修改的信息隐藏方法”着重探讨了如何通过修改软件源代码来实现信息的隐秘传输。这种方法既能够保持通信的隐蔽性,又能够保证信息的完整性。 一、信息隐藏基本原理 信息隐藏是指将秘密信息(隐藏信息)嵌入到载体(如文本、图像、音频或视频)中,使得非授权者难以察觉其存在。在电信设备中,源码是软件运行的基础,通过对源码进行修改,可以将隐藏信息巧妙地融入其中,而不影响程序的正常运行,这种技术被称为源码级的信息隐藏。 二、源码修改信息隐藏方法 1. 静态代码嵌入:在源代码中添加特定的指令序列或数据,这些序列或数据看似普通,实则包含了隐藏信息。例如,通过修改循环次数、变量赋值等方式,可以将二进制秘密信息编码为源码中的算术表达式。 2. 动态代码嵌入:利用程序执行时的控制流和数据流特性,动态地隐藏信息。例如,通过改变函数调用顺序、条件分支等,可以在运行时动态生成隐藏信息。 3. 模糊化技术:通过混淆、加密等手段,使源码变得难以理解,同时将隐藏信息巧妙地分散其中,增加破解难度。 三、信息隐藏的安全性和鲁棒性 1. 安全性:好的信息隐藏方法应确保即使源码被公开,隐藏的信息也难以被提取。这通常需要对隐藏策略进行精心设计,使其不易被逆向工程分析。 2. 鲁棒性:信息隐藏系统应该能够在一定程度上抵抗各种攻击,如编译器优化、代码压缩、错误修复等,以保证隐藏信息的完整性和可恢复性。 四、在电信设备中的应用 在电信设备中,源码修改的信息隐藏方法可以用于以下场景: - 设备间的秘密通信:通过隐藏信息传递密钥或其他敏感数据,增强通信安全性。 - 版权保护:软件开发商可以将自己的标识或版权信息隐藏在源码中,防止非法复制和篡改。 - 故障检测:在源码中隐藏故障检测代码,当设备出现异常时,隐藏信息会触发特定行为,帮助诊断问题。 五、挑战与未来方向 尽管源码修改的信息隐藏技术有诸多优势,但面临一些挑战,如提高隐藏容量、防止信息泄露、兼顾软件性能等。随着量子计算和人工智能的发展,未来的源码级信息隐藏可能会结合这些新技术,实现更高层次的隐藏和检测机制。 "电信设备-基于源码修改的信息隐藏方法"是一个深入探讨电信设备安全性的专题,对于理解和实施源码级信息隐藏具有重要意义。学习并掌握这一技术,可以帮助我们更好地保护电信设备的数据安全,防止非法侵入和信息泄露。
- 1
- 粉丝: 169
- 资源: 21万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Screenshot_20241117_024114_com.huawei.browser.jpg
- .turing.dat
- shopex升级补丁只针对 485.78660版本升级至485.80603版本 其它版本的请勿使用!
- 基于Django和HTML的新疆地区水稻产量影响因素可视化分析系统(含数据集)
- windows conan2应用构建模板
- 3_base.apk.1
- 鼎微R16中控升级包R16-4.5.10-20170221及强制升级方法
- 基于STM32F103C8T6的4g模块(air724ug)
- 基于Java技术的ASC学业支持中心并行项目开发设计源码
- 基于Java和微信支付的wxmall开源卖票商城设计源码